Up to 80 percent of learning happens informally. The arrival of second-generation portals offers us the ability to integrate information, learning, expertise, tools and applications around a work context to truly deliver on-demand learning to the performer. This ushers in the possibility to design human-, learning-, technical- and performance-support at the business process layer. Explore the emergence of second-generation portals and challenge the conventional wisdom about how we view learning in the workplace. Initial models for “learning in context” will be provided along with some proof-of-concept demonstrations. |
